Common Issues with Bi-Fold Doors
Bi-fold doors are made up of several panels that fold together when opened or closed. They are generally installed on a track system that allows them to move efficiently. However, gradually, the doors can end up being misaligned, the tracks can end up being blocked, and the hinges can break. Here are some common problems that can accompany bi-fold doors:
Misaligned doorsSticky or jammed doorsUsed out hinges or rollersBroken or damaged panelsFaulty locking mechanisms

Step-by-Step Guide to Bi-Fold Door Repair
Here are some step-by-step guides on how to repair common problems with bi-fold doors:
1. Repairing Misaligned Doors
Misaligned doors can be caused by loose hinges, uneven tracks, or warped panels. Here's how to fix them:
Check the hinges and tighten up any loose screws.Examine the tracks and clean out any particles or dust.Adjust the rollers or hinges to ensure proper alignment.If the panels are warped, consider changing them.2. Repairing Sticky or Jammed Doors
Sticky or jammed doors can be triggered by worn out rollers, misaligned tracks, or extreme dust accumulation. Here's how to repair them:
Clean out any particles or dust from the tracks and rollers.Apply lube to the rollers or hinges.Inspect the positioning of the tracks and adjust them if essential.If the rollers are broken, consider replacing them.3. Replacing Worn Out Hinges or Rollers
Worn out hinges or rollers can cause the doors to become misaligned or sticky. Here's how to replace them:
Remove the old hinges or rollers and tidy the location.Apply lube to the new hinges or rollers.Install the brand-new hinges or rollers and tighten any loose screws.Test the doors to make sure appropriate positioning and smooth operation.4. Fixing Broken or Damaged Panels
Broken or damaged panels can be brought on by accidents, weather damage, or wear and tear. Here's how to repair them:
Assess the damage and figure out if the panel requires to be replaced.Remove the damaged panel and clean the location.Apply wood glue or epoxy to the damaged area and connect a new panel.Evaluate the doors to make sure appropriate positioning and smooth operation.5. Repairing Faulty Locking Mechanisms
Defective locking mechanisms can be triggered by worn out parts, misaligned doors, or improper setup. Here's how to fix them:
Check the locking system and recognize any broken parts.Clean the locking mechanism and apply lubricant.Change the locking system to guarantee correct positioning.Test the locking mechanism to guarantee it is working appropriately.
Preventative Maintenance for Bi-Fold Doors
To prevent common problems with bi-fold doors, it's vital to perform routine maintenance jobs. Here are some suggestions:
Clean the tracks and rollers frequently to prevent dust accumulation.Oil the hinges and rollers to ensure smooth operation.Check the positioning of the doors and adjust them if needed.Check the locking mechanism and replace any used out parts.
